Why Delaware Stands Out for Annual Grant Opportunities for Educators and Community Projects

Delaware's unique blend of history, geography, and economic factors make it an attractive location for educators and community-focused projects seeking annual grant opportunities. The state's compact size, with only three counties, allows for efficient collaboration and resource sharing among organizations and agencies. The Delaware Department of Education, for example, works closely with local school districts and community groups to identify and support innovative initiatives that enhance learning environments and improve educational experiences.

A Distinct Regional Fit

Delaware's location in the Mid-Atlantic region, bordered by New Jersey, Pennsylvania, and Maryland, provides access to a diverse range of resources and expertise. The state's proximity to major cities like Philadelphia and Baltimore also creates opportunities for partnerships and collaborations with larger organizations. Additionally, Delaware's coastal economy and tourist industry present unique challenges and opportunities for community-focused projects, particularly in areas like Sussex County, where tourism is a significant driver of the local economy. The Delaware Tourism Office, a division of the Delaware Department of State, works with local communities to promote and support tourism-related initiatives that can be eligible for grant funding.

Delaware's demographic features also distinguish it from neighboring states. The state has a relatively high percentage of residents living in poverty, particularly in rural areas like Kent County. This has led to a strong focus on initiatives that address economic development, education, and healthcare disparities. Organizations like the Delaware Community Foundation provide critical support for community projects that address these needs, and grant opportunities are available to support innovative solutions. The state's history and cultural heritage also play a significant role in shaping grant opportunities. The Delaware Humanities Council, for example, provides grants to support projects that promote the humanities and cultural understanding. "Delaware humanities grants" are available to support a range of initiatives, from museum exhibitions to literary festivals. This focus on cultural heritage and the humanities reflects the state's rich history and its commitment to preserving and promoting its cultural assets.
